Abstract

A lithotripsy measurement arrangement for calibrating ultrasonic shock wave sensors includes a generator 32 that is arranged at one end of a steepening tube 31 filled with a sound-carrying medium 3. Additionally, the arrangement includes an optical sensor head 34 which measures the measurement shock waves generated by generator 32 and steepened in steepening tube 31, and an analysis unit 10 optically connected via a fiber bundle 50 to sensor head 34. The end 5 of fiber bundle 50 is arranged in a measurement volume 4 inside sensor head 34 opposite a reflector region 22 of a film 2, to irradiate reflector region 22 with light and sense the reflected light. Film 2 is fastened to housing 13 of sensor head 34. Because of its low mass, film 2 follows the movement of the molecules of medium 3 when a measurement shock wave strikes an outer surface 20 of film 2. The corresponding excursion of film 2 is analyzed as a change in intensity of the light reflected back from reflector region 22 into fiber bundle 50.
